[QUOTE="Hobo, post: 933969, member: 11521"]If you think this coin has NT (natural toning) you seriously need to study up on toning. [URL="http://rover.ebay.com/rover/1/711-53200-19255-0/1?type=3&campid=5335874456&toolid=10001&mpre=http%3A%2F%2Fcgi.ebay.com%2F1925-Lexington-Concord-Commem-Half-Dollar-Rainbow_W0QQitemZ130404888220QQcategoryZ3355QQcmdZViewItemQQ_trksidZp3907.m263QQ_trkparmsZalgo%253DSIC%2526itu%253DUCI%25252BIA%25252BUA%25252BFICS%25252BUFI%25252BDDSIC%2526otn%253D8%2526pmod%253D310208032245%2526po%253DLLIW%2526ps%253D63%2526clkid%253D7483592753877720350"]1925 Lexinton Concord Commem. Half Dollar Rainbow[/URL] Check out the seller's other toned coins: [URL]http://shop.ebay.com/cwbyup1051/m.html?_nkw=&_armrs=1&_from=&_ipg=&_trksid=p4340[/URL] When a seller has numerous toned coins for sale that all have similar looking toning that should be a clue that it is AT (artificial toning). Also, it is very, very unusual for a coin to have identical rainbow toning on both sides (like the Lexington Concord Half).[/QUOTE]
